> Bristol does support this (indeed, nearly anything that's on the GUI
> is midi cc controllable, buttons, sliders, knobs etc).
> To get it work, you just need to middle click on the drawbar on the
> GUI, then move the physical fader on your controller and the
> connection should be set.
>
> With my M-audio oxygen 61 at least, it works flawlessly.
